Blockchain Supply Chain Program Objectives
Upon successful completion of this intensive program, participants will be able to:
Analyze real-life use cases for different supply chain models
Construct a strategy to make use of blockchain for varying supply chain needs
Comprehend blockchain fundamentals
Explain smart contracts and consensus protocols
Compare public vs private chains required for different blockchain solutions.
Capability to coordinate and implement blockchain solutions for supply chain stakeholder needs.

Prerequisites
No prior blockchain or computer programming experience is required. Prior experience in logistics and supply chain management is ideal. Recent graduates and existing supply chain management students are also well suited for this course.
Target Audience
Specific job titles that would benefit from this program include Director Logistics & Distribution, Business Analyst, Contracts Manager, Procurement Manager, Project Manager, Transportation Coordinator, and aspiring supply chain professionals.
